The Iraq War has forever changed the lives of many veterans. With this powerful documentary, viewers can get an eye-opening look at the experiences of Iraq War vets from across the country and understand why some of them have come to oppose the war.

From Illinois, we meet Dave who believed he was there to help the Iraqi people, only to find families living in rubble with no running water or electricity. From New York City, Fernando speaks out against corporations profiting off those soldiers coming mostly from working-class backgrounds. Abbie is a veteran who has struggled to resume her normal life after returning home.

We also hear stories from Eric in Chicago and Jimmy in North Carolina about innocent civilian deaths at checkpoints due to accidental slaughter and ordered fire respectively. The impact on these vets can be seen long after their return home and how they struggle with their experiences.

This film, divided into ten topical sections such as Why Are We In Iraq?, Support The Troops, On Coming Home etc., provides an insightful view of what it’s really like for veterans who served in Iraq.
